Assistant Professor of Japanese

The Department of World Languages and Literatures at Texas State University invites applications for a tenure-track Assistant Professor of Japanese. Area of Specialization: Open. Preferred Area(s) of Specialization: Japanese language, literature, and culture. This is a full-time position with a nine-month academic year appointment to begin Fall 2022.

Applicants must have the Ph.D. or be ABD in Japanese or comparable field. Ph.D. in hand is required by the time of employment. Applicants must demonstrate native or near-native fluency in Japanese, excellence in language teaching, and a strong commitment to scholarly research, active student engagement, and academic program development.
